Sword and Shieldâs Galar Pokédex, while smaller than the National Pokédex of Sun and Moon, can be a lot of work to complete!Youâll have to do plenty of searching, leveling up and trading to get all 400 Pokémon, but there are several ways to speed up the process. Each generation has its own iteration of the Flying-Type bird Pokémon that the player can catch in the early game, but half have still been left out in Sword and Shield and the expansions. For those who aren’t aware, Psuedolegendaries are Pokémon whose base stats total 600, matching their strength to that of a Legendary/Mythical Pokémon.
